Java: Compilação de classes Java – Parte II


Pessoal, dando seguimento ao artigo anterior (Java: Compilação de classes Java – Parte I), vamos ver uma visão geral na compilação de classes na linguagem Java.

Na tecnologia Java, temos três entidades:

  • Morpheu (JDK);
  • Neo (JRE); e
  • Trinity (JVM).
JDK, JRE e JVM

JDK, JRE e JVM

Como essas entidades trabalham?

Continuar lendo

Java: Compilação de classes Java – Parte I


Galera, no nosso dia a dia, utilizamos programas de computadores para os mais diversos fins, seja para nos auxiliar em nosso trabalho, seja para usos pessoais.

Podemos dizer que um programa de computador é um conjunto de instruções que:

  • Possui um determinado fim, por exemplo, o Photoshop para edição de imagens; e
  • É executado por um processador.

Mas para haja essa execução pelo processador, o programa precisa estar em uma linguagem que o processador possa entender: a linguagem de máquina. Ela é composta apenas de 0 e 1.

– Pow, Rogerão, mas como vamos programar escrevendo apenas 0 e 1? Tu é doido, macho?

Continuar lendo